Improved Reliability and Performance
Windows Vista with Service Pack 1 and improvements delivered by hardware and software partners increase the reliability, performance, and compatibility of Windows Vista-based PCs.

With Windows Vista with SP1, many of the most common causes of operating system crashes and hangs have been addressed. Windows Vista includes new, innovative technologies that help pinpoint and diagnose issues reported anonymously by Windows Vista-based PCs from millions of users who have elected to have their PC send us system information.

Windows Vista with SP1 supports a number of important new technology standards, so it will keep making your PC easier and more enjoyable to use for years to come.

Safety
Windows Vista with Service Pack 1 helps protect your family and your personal information from threats from malicious software and phishing scams and helps you keep your PC backed-up and running smoothly.

Parental Controls help parents keep children safer while using PCs through convenient tools to manage and monitor children's computer use, access to websites, and ability to play certain games and use certain applications.

PCs running Windows Vista are 60% less likely to be infected with viruses, worms and rootkits than PCs running Windows XP SP2.

Windows Internet Explorer 7 helps protect your PC and your personal information against malicious software, fraudulent websites, and online phishing scams. New phishing attacks are more than 25 times as common as new viruses, and over 20,000 fraudulent phishing websites are created every month. Internet Explorer 7 is now blocking nearly one million inadvertent attempts to access fake phishing sites per week.

Help defend your PC against pop-ups, slow performance, and security threats caused by spyware and other unwanted software with Windows Defender. Windows Defender in Windows Vista automatically scans Internet Explorer 7 downloads to help bring spyware to your attention before it can infect your computer.

More easily back-up the content on your PC--including digital photos, music, movies, and documents--with Scheduled and Network Backup.

Ease
It's easier and faster than ever to find, use, manage and share the information on your PC or on the Web with Windows Vista with SP1.

Most Windows Vista-based PCs boot in less than a minute, which can be an improvement over Windows XP boot times.

The Windows Vista sleep and resume features can bring your PC to life in a snap. The vast majority of Windows Vista-based PCs resume from sleep in less than six seconds.

See everything you're working on more clearly with Windows Aero and quickly switch between windows or tasks using Windows Flip 3D.

Find it fast! Simply type something about a file, picture, or song, such as a word contained in a document or e-mail message, the artist of a song, or the date a picture was taken, and Instant Search will bring back any matches instantly.

Organize a lifetime of photos and movies with ease using Windows Photo Gallery. Tag your photos by date, keyword, star rating or any identifying label you choose--so you can find them anytime you want them.

Display live information, like weather, stocks, and news, directly on your desktop with easy-to-use Gadgets and Windows Sidebar.

View multiple web pages simultaneously with Quick Tabs in Windows Internet Explorer 7.

Get up and running faster than ever with Windows Easy Transfer that automatically copies your files and settings from your old PC.

Parental controls are only good for very young children
The Vista parental controls have a lot to be desired. Here are the parts that do work. You can set the time that the child can use the computer. The high level settings works. Accept for websites that most people agree are for children, the rest of the internet is blocked. And overriding a website to be allowed does work. The only problem is that you can't set it to allow a website for a single logon sesson. The only options are "always allow" or "always disallow". Adding new websites to the Allow list is controlled through an interface or an XML file.

For any child above the age of 9 (needs to start doing research on the computer for school), don't count on the medium setting. The rating star image on Buyadvd, and the ability to see this product's page is blocked, but I could very easily see a picture of Male private parts -- a picture that would that be allowed to be sold to a child under 18 if it was in a magazine. I would type in a word in simple.[...] and it would block the page, but when I typed in the same word in en.[...] or common[...] , the images were displayed. If a page on simple.[...] had "Sexual reproduction" the page was blocked, but when that category was removed and it only had "Male reproduction" and "Female reproduction" the page was not blocked. I did these tests both using both the medium setting (standard) and the custom with "Sex education" set to blocked.

Something is working the way it is supposed to be working, because I have been able to block sex education pages on simple.[...] , but still be able to see pages like elephant. The main problem is that there is no way to see the filters, and there is no way to add words to the filter. [...] websites can be imported and exported, but not the filter. Nor is there any interface to the filter list.

Overall, don't count on the Parental controls. Consider either buying a third part filtering program and subscribing to an online encyclopedia program.

Be Careful, VERY Careful, on this `Upgrade'
This `upgrade' will not install on a `clean' hard drive, nor will it `upgrade' XP Pro. There is a work around, but it involves duplicate installs and other technical `workarounds' so if you are not technically savvy, don't get this `upgrade'.

If you do want to consider this `upgrade' be aware that Windows Vista Home Premium does not include FAX capability and needs the Office 2007 suite along with Outlook 2007 (which does not support animated gif's, among other things) for most eMail.

I would not consider Windows Vista Home Premium an `upgrade' as it requires more system memory, is a step backward in features, and more cumbersome to use than XP.
 
Go MAC - Windows Vista is complete junk.
I am an attorney practicing in Silicon Valley. From a user's perspective, Windows Vista is a step backward from Windows 98. Remember all those freezes and crashes we use to have in Windows 98, a problem that got much better with 2000 and XP? Well, they're back... Here are some of the problems Vista has caused on my machine and I'm not the only one who has seen these....

(1) Printers deinstall themselves after sleep mode.
(2) Send via email from MS office programs does not work and causes a system hang (need to kill open routines with task manager).
(3) IE freezes frequently (>40% of the time).
(4) Microsoft websites express puzzlement at these things (aka, complete lack of adequate testing before release).
(5) I have much faster hardware, with much greater processing capacity, but the system runs much slower (again, a Vista issue).
